三相电压不平衡时二阶广义积分器锁相环设计方法
Design of Phase Locked Loop Based on Second Order Generalized Integrator for Unbalanced Three-phase Voltage

In order to solve the active power filte(r APF)control requirements in the three-phase voltage unbalance,the amplitude,frequency and phase information about fundamental positive sequence component of grid voltage are obtained quickly and accurately is critical. For this problem,a method named second order generalized integrator phaselocked loop(SOGI- PLL)of adaptive frequency performance characteristics which could achieve a positive sequence component information extraction was proposed. The simulation and experimental results show that the proposed method can quickly and accurately extract the amplitude,frequency and phase information about positive sequence component of grid voltage in three-phase voltage unbalance,and has good performance in adaptability of frequency.关键词
